ANNANDALE-ON-HUDSON, NY - The Bard women's lacrosse team started a back-to-back Liberty League weekend, hosting the Ithaca Bombers, ranked #17 in the latest IWLCA Coaches Poll.
The visitors came out strong and earned a 24-0 win over the Raptors on Ferrari Field.
Bard battled throughout the game and both of the team's goalkeepers,
Lexie Blackburn and
Martha Pasatiempo, came up with several good saves. Blackburn made five saves in just over 20 minutes of action, and Pasatiempo made four saves in nearly 40 minutes.
While the defensive unit was pushed by the deep Ithaca squad, the group fought to the final whistle.
Maggy Peyton had a pair of shots on goal, and
Morgan Ruhle and
Lily Clough each collected a pair of ground balls.
The Raptors return to the field quickly, hosting RPI on Saturday afternoon at 1pm.
